Gorakhpur, April 7: A 20-year-old Ukrainian model Daria Molcha, who was arrested from Gorakhpur hotel on April 3 by the Uttar Pradesh Special Task Force (STF) had made various revelations. Molcha was arrested on charges of staying illegally in India without a valid visa. As per report published in the Hindustan Times, The Ukrainian model has revealed details of her ‘Indian friends’ who facilitated her entry into the country via Nepal using fake documents, including a forged Indian driving license.

Molcha, who is currently lodged in Gorakhpur district jail revealed her contacts with Gorakhpur-based businessman Anuj Poddar and Delhi-based businessmen Imsham Kashif. Apart from Poddar and Kashif  the police and security agencies will interrogate her other ‘Indian friends’ also.

According to the police, objectionable photographs of Molcha with a senior Delhi cop, an airport official and some Kolkata cadet officers have been recovered from her smart phones and tablets. The police have informed the Intelligence Bureau because they believed that she was used as a honeytrap to access confidential information regarding national security.

The Ukrainian model was booked under various sections of  Indian Penal Code (IPC). While interacting with media, STF inspector Satya Prakash said that the model, who was arrested with 18,000 US dollars, smart phones and tablets, was booked under sections of IPC dealing with document forgery, committing fraud and under the Foreigners Act.

According to report published in the Hindustan Times, STF officials said that Daria entered India illegally in March this year. She stayed at Imsham’s house in New Friends Colony for 15 days. On April 2 she took a flight to Gorakhpur using fake documents. Molcha was scheduled to leave for the Gulf via Nepal with Anuj Poddar. The police arrested her before she could leave.

Assuring stern action against those who helped her illegal stay in the country, SSP Shalabh Mathur assured to nab all those who helped her staying illegaly in india. As published in the Hindustan Times, SSP Mathur said, “A fake driving licence has been recovered from the Ukrainian model who had crossed into India without any valid visa. The issue is serious. Those who helped her cross the border and also gave her shelter are under scanner and action will be taken against them. For now a probe is on. Soon the whole racket will be busted.”

The Ukrainian model arrived in India for the first time in 2016. She worked as a model with Karma modeling agency. She started visiting Urban Club to increase her contacts, where she met Poddar and Imsham Kashif. However, due to her suspicious activities, her visa was blacklisted and she left the country. She again arrived in India on a tourist visa in December 2017, but was made to return from the airport due to the government ban on her stay in the country.

This year in March, Molcha entered the country using fake documents. Poddar and Kashif helped her in obtaining fake documents. Security agencies are probing the reason of her continuous visit India despite a ban and her motive to make Indian friends. Security agencies are also trying to figure out her motive to visit China in 2013 along with other Gulf countries before coming to India.
